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To decrease automobile accidents which are heretofore caused by the absence of good forward visibility in a rainy day by providing the end of a light transparent bar-shaped member with a light emitting means for emitting light, providing its body part with a detaining implement and constituting a circuit for connecting this light emitting means, a battery and a switch. SOLUTION: The light transparent bar-shaped member 6A to be installed on ribs 3 for spreading a sheet 2 on an umbrella is formed of a flexible synthetic resin, such as a polycarbonate or an acryl, resin to a square shape. The body part of this member has the detaining implement 18a for detaining the member to the ribs 3 at the proper point of its lateral surface part. The end of the light transparent bar-shaped member 6A is provided with an LED (light emitting diode) 7a as the light emitting means for casting light. A connector 15a to be energized to the LED 7a is connected Via a lead wire 9. The detaining implement 18a and the ribs 3 are freely movable with each other in the state of widening the free end part of the detaining implement 18a outward and fitting the implement to the ribs 3.

Description of the Related Art On a rainy day, when walking along a night road with an umbrella, the field of view may be narrowed by the umbrella, which makes it difficult to see the surroundings, and it may be very dangerous that an automobile or the like does not notice the approach. Especially when the wind is blowing from the front, it is inevitable that the umbrella is tilted forward, and the oncoming vehicle cannot be seen, which is very dangerous. Also on the car side, on a rainy day, the visibility is bad and the windshield is cloudy, the front is not clearly visible, especially if the pedestrian holding an umbrella wears a dark umbrella in a dark clothes Not easy and very dangerous. Therefore, in the past, there has been a technique in which a light bulb is attached to the handle of an umbrella and the light emitted from the bulb makes it visible.
(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 6-296510, Japanese Utility Model Laid-Open No. 7-13214) However, the light is a narrow portion, and the light is weak and difficult to see from a long distance, and the light is hidden depending on the tilt of the umbrella, and the visual Sometimes you can't. There are also umbrellas with reflective tape attached, but the headlights of the car are facing downwards, and the umbrella is illuminated very close to it, so it was not very effective in terms of safety.

S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ION The present invention has been made in view of the safety of pedestrians holding such an umbrella on a conventional rainy day, that is, a motor vehicle and a headlight 2 facing downward.
To enable a person driving a wheeled vehicle to equip a conventional umbrella with a light emitter that enables pedestrians to be fully visually recognized by the light emission of the umbrella even from a long distance, and that the umbrella can be seen even in any tilted state. To do.

When the light emitting device of the present invention is provided in a conventional umbrella, the light emitting portion emits a linear light in a radial shape, so that a wide portion can be illuminated and can be seen from a long distance. Even if there is, the luminous linear part is not hidden by the umbrella sheet, so it can be recognized without fail. Further, if the light transmissive member is made of a fluorescent member, the brightness is further increased, and it is possible to easily visually recognize it even from a distance at night. Furthermore, if the light emitting means is blinked, a reminder can be prompted.

EXAMPLE 1 FIG. 1 shows Example 1 of the present invention.
FIG. 1 (a) shows the structure of a light-transmissive rod-shaped member 6A attached to the bone 3 that stretches the sheet 2 on the umbrella 1. The light-transmissive rod-shaped member 6A is formed into a square shape with a flexible synthetic resin such as polycarbonate or acrylic, and a locking tool 18a for locking the bone 3 is provided at an appropriate position on the lateral surface of the body portion. L as the light emitting means 7 for introducing light into the end portion of the sex rod-shaped member 6A
An ED (light emitting diode) 7a is provided, and a connector 15a for energizing the LED 7a is connected via a lead wire 9. FIG. 1B shows a state in which the locking tool 18a is inserted into the bone 3, and the free end portion of the locking tool 18a is expanded outward and fitted into the bone 3. Locking tool 18 in this state
The a and the bone 3 are loosely inserted and can move freely with respect to each other. In this way, the light-transmissive rod-shaped member 6A is provided in the plural bones 3,
It is provided by being inserted through 3 ..., and is connected to the connector 15b of the drive unit 13 shown in FIG. The driving unit 13 is provided with a battery holder 17 accommodating the battery 8, a switch 10 and a blinking means 11, and is formed into a cylindrical shape. A round bar or the like is inserted by a screw 19 so that the tightening can be performed. In FIG. 1 (c), the drive unit 13 is fixed to the butt 12, and the connector 15a of the eight light-transmitting rod-shaped members 6A is shown.
Is connected to the connector 15b of the drive unit 13 and mounted on the bone 3 by the locking tool 18a. In this state, when the umbrella is opened and closed, the bones 3 and the light-transmissive rod-shaped members 6A are slightly displaced from each other, but as described above, the two float so that the umbrella can be smoothly opened and closed without being caught. . EFFECT OF THE INVENTION By mounting and mounting the light-emitting device for an umbrella of the present invention on a conventional umbrella, since the light-emitting portion of the umbrella emits linearly in a radial shape, it is far from a known luminous umbrella. However, it is easy to see, and even if the umbrella is tilted, the light-emitting linear part is not hidden by the umbrella sheet, so it is always visible. In addition, the light-transmissive member made of a fluorescent member emits light with greater brightness and can be easily visually recognized even from a distance.
Further, the configuration in which the light emitting means is made to blink can prompt the attention. Also in terms of efficiency,
Since the light of the light emitting means can be condensed and projected on the light transmissive member, the light projecting efficiency is very good as compared with the conventional light of a light bulb diffused in all directions. Further, the present invention can be mounted on an umbrella as a replacement and can be used for a longer period than the replacement life of one umbrella according to the present invention. In the present invention having the above-mentioned effects, it is possible to drastically reduce the number of automobile accidents that have conventionally occurred because the front side is not clearly visible on a rainy day. It also has the effect of visually appealing the aesthetic sense.
